State: New Jersey

Poverty

9.8% of women in New Jersey live in poverty. The national figure is 10.9%.

25.4% of families headed by single mothers in New Jersey live in poverty.

National figure: 30.6%

11.5% of women 65 and older in New Jersey live in poverty.

National figure: 10.8%

Wage Gap

Women in New Jersey typically make $0.82 for every dollar paid to men. The national figure is $0.81 .

Black women in New Jersey typically make 58 cents for every dollar paid to white men.

National figure: $0.65

Latina women in New Jersey typically make 47 cents for every dollar paid to white men.

National figure: $0.58

Black women refers to those who self-identified in the Current Population Survey or American Community Survey as Black or African American. White men refers to those who identified themselves as white, but who indicated that they are not of Hispanic, Latino, or Spanish origin. Latinas refers to women of any race who identified themselves to be of Hispanic, Latino, or Spanish origin.

Health Insurance

9.6% of women aged 19-64 in New Jersey are uninsured. Nationally, 9.6% are uninsured.

10.7% of women of reproductive age (19-54) in New Jersey are uninsured.

National figure: 10.4%

14.1% of women in New Jersey reported not receiving health care at some point in the last 12 months due to cost.

National figure: 13.5%
